Many Fronius models offer digital process control. This means you can precisely dial in settings like amperage, pulse frequency, and even the pre- and post-gas flow times. This granular control is essential for delicate work on thin materials or when welding exotic alloys. It allows you to adapt the welding process to the specific demands of your project, rather than forcing the material to conform to the machine’s limitations.
Another significant advantage is the availability of AC/DC welding capabilities in many of their units. For DIYers working with a variety of metals, this is crucial. DC is ideal for steel, stainless steel, and other ferrous metals, while AC is necessary for effectively welding aluminum. Having both in one machine eliminates the need for multiple welding setups.
Consider models that feature high-frequency (HF) arc starting. This technology allows you to initiate the arc without physically touching the tungsten to the workpiece. It’s cleaner, reduces tungsten contamination, and makes starting the weld much easier and more precise. This is a hallmark of quality TIG welders and something Fronius excels at.
Powering Your Projects: Amperage and Duty Cycle Explained
When choosing any welder, understanding its power output is fundamental. For a fronius tig welder, two key specifications to pay close attention to are amperage and duty cycle. These dictate what kind of materials you can effectively weld and for how long you can do it.
The amperage setting directly controls the heat input into your weld joint. For thinner materials, like sheet metal for a custom car panel or small fabrication projects, lower amperages (e.g., 20-50 amps) are needed to prevent burn-through. For thicker steel or aluminum, you’ll need higher amperages (e.g., 100-200+ amps) to ensure proper fusion and penetration. Fronius machines typically offer a wide amperage range, giving you the flexibility to tackle diverse projects.
The duty cycle refers to how long a welder can operate at a given amperage before needing to cool down. It’s usually expressed as a percentage over a 10-minute period. For example, a 60% duty cycle at 150 amps means the welder can operate at 150 amps for 6 minutes out of every 10-minute cycle. If you’re doing extended welding on larger projects, a higher duty cycle is essential to avoid constant downtime. For most DIY applications, a duty cycle that comfortably exceeds your typical project duration is sufficient.
Fronius welders often feature robust cooling systems, which contribute to better duty cycle performance. This means you can spend more time welding and less time waiting for your machine to recover, a significant benefit for productivity.
Mastering Different Metals: Aluminum, Stainless Steel, and More
The versatility of TIG welding, especially with a high-quality fronius tig welder, allows you to work with a broad spectrum of metals. Each metal presents unique challenges, and understanding how to adjust your settings and technique is key to achieving excellent results.
Welding Aluminum
Aluminum is notoriously tricky to TIG weld due to its oxide layer and high thermal conductivity. A fronius tig welder equipped with AC output is crucial here. The AC waveform helps break through the oxide layer and clean the weld puddle.
- AC Frequency: Adjusting the AC frequency can significantly impact the arc cone shape and penetration. Higher frequencies tend to create a tighter, more focused arc, which is great for detailed work.
- AC Balance: This controls the amount of cleaning action versus penetration. Finding the right balance is a bit of an art, but generally, more cleaning (higher electrode negative) is needed for thicker, oxidized aluminum.
- Material Preparation: Thoroughly cleaning aluminum with a dedicated stainless steel brush and degreaser is non-negotiable.
Welding Stainless Steel
Stainless steel is a favorite for many DIYers due to its corrosion resistance and aesthetic appeal. TIG welding stainless steel is typically done using DC electrode negative (DCEN).
- Low Heat Input: Stainless steel has lower thermal conductivity than mild steel, meaning heat can build up and cause distortion or sugaring (oxidization) on the backside. Maintaining a focused arc and moving efficiently is important.
- Tungsten Selection: Pure tungsten or lanthanated tungsten (blue tip) are good choices for DC welding.
- Shielding Gas: Pure Argon is the standard shielding gas for stainless steel.
Welding Mild Steel
Mild steel is often the go-to for many DIY projects, from fabricating brackets to structural components. It’s generally the most forgiving metal to TIG weld using DCEN.
- Penetration: Achieving good penetration is key for strong mild steel welds. Adjusting amperage and travel speed will be your primary controls.
- Filler Material: Matching the filler rod to the base metal is important, though for mild steel, ER70S-2 or ER70S-6 are common choices.
- Shielding Gas: Pure Argon works well, but some fabricators opt for a mix with a small percentage of helium for increased heat and penetration on thicker sections.
Essential Accessories and Safety Gear for Your Fronius TIG Welder
Beyond the welder itself, a few key accessories and, most importantly, safety gear are indispensable for a productive and safe TIG welding experience. Investing in quality items here will pay dividends in weld quality and your well-being.
Must-Have Accessories:
- TIG Torch and Consumables: Ensure your torch is appropriately sized for the amperage you’ll be using. This includes tungsten electrodes (ground to a point for DC, rounded for AC aluminum), collets, collet bodies, and ceramic cups. Having a variety of cup sizes allows for better gas coverage in different joint configurations.
- Shielding Gas: Typically, 100% Argon is used for most TIG applications. You’ll need a regulator and a gas cylinder.
- Filler Rods: Always have filler rods that match the base metal you are welding.
- Clamps and Fixturing: Good quality C-clamps, welding magnets, and potentially even a welding table are crucial for holding your workpieces securely in place before and during welding.
Safety First: Your Personal Protective Equipment (PPE)
Welding involves significant hazards, and proper PPE is non-negotiable.
- Auto-Darkening Welding Helmet: This is your most critical piece of safety equipment. Look for a helmet with a good shade range (e.g., Shade 9-13) and a wide field of view. An auto-darkening feature allows you to see clearly when not welding and instantly darkens when the arc strikes.
- Welding Gloves: TIG gloves are typically thinner and more dexterous than MIG or stick welding gloves, allowing for better control of the torch and filler rod. Opt for high-quality leather.
- Flame-Resistant Clothing: Wear a flame-resistant jacket or shirt made of cotton or leather. Avoid synthetic materials, which can melt and cause severe burns. Long sleeves and pants are essential.
- Safety Glasses: Even with a helmet, wear safety glasses underneath to protect your eyes from sparks and debris.
- Respirator: For certain metals, especially galvanized steel or when welding in confined spaces, a respirator can protect you from hazardous fumes.
Setting Up Your Workspace for TIG Welding Success
Creating an effective and safe workspace is crucial for any DIY project, and TIG welding is no exception. A well-organized and safe area will not only protect you but also improve your workflow and the quality of your welds.
Ventilation is Key
Good ventilation is paramount when TIG welding. Fumes from the welding process, especially when working with galvanized steel or certain alloys, can be harmful. If you’re working in a garage, ensure you have ample airflow. Open doors and windows, or consider using an exhaust fan to pull fumes away from your breathing zone.
Lighting and Power
Adequate lighting is important for seeing your weld puddle clearly. Ensure your welding area is well-lit, but avoid glare that can obscure your view. You’ll also need a reliable power source for your fronius tig welder. Make sure your electrical circuit can handle the welder’s power draw, and use appropriate heavy-duty extension cords if needed.
Fire Prevention
Welding produces sparks and heat, making fire prevention a top priority. Keep your workspace clean and free of flammable materials like rags, sawdust, or solvents. Have a fire extinguisher (Class ABC or CO2) readily accessible and know how to use it. Consider placing a fire-resistant mat under your welding area.
Organization and Accessibility
Keep your tools and materials organized and within easy reach. A welding cart or sturdy shelving can help keep your welder, gas cylinder, consumables, and tools tidy. Having everything accessible reduces interruptions and makes the welding process smoother.
